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/silverlight/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Google cloud platform 仅在GCP中找不到www.googleapis.com上的服务器_Google Cloud Platform_Google Kubernetes Engine_Gke Networking - Fatal编程技术网

Google cloud platform 仅在GCP中找不到www.googleapis.com上的服务器

Google cloud platform 仅在GCP中找不到www.googleapis.com上的服务器,google-cloud-platform,google-kubernetes-engine,gke-networking,Google Cloud Platform,Google Kubernetes Engine,Gke Networking,我知道有一些问题与这个问题类似。但就我而言,这个问题只发生在GCP上。我们已经在AKS(Azure)中运行了将近一年的服务,没有一次出现过。在我们移动到GCP GKE之后,Python应用程序的一些请求就出现了错误:无法在www.googleapis.com上找到服务器。在大多数情况下,请求是有效的,因此它似乎是随机的。我已经尝试在我的云Nat中增加TCP超时和每个VM实例的最小端口数。我们正在使用GKE运行服务,并为网络设置了云Nat网关 GCP上是否存在可能导致问题的独占设置?我找到了问题所

我知道有一些问题与这个问题类似。但就我而言,这个问题只发生在GCP上。我们已经在AKS(Azure)中运行了将近一年的服务,没有一次出现过。在我们移动到GCP GKE之后,Python应用程序的一些请求就出现了错误:
无法在www.googleapis.com
上找到服务器。在大多数情况下,请求是有效的,因此它似乎是随机的。我已经尝试在我的云Nat中增加TCP超时和每个VM实例的最小端口数。我们正在使用GKE运行服务,并为网络设置了云Nat网关


GCP上是否存在可能导致问题的独占设置?

我找到了问题所在。kube dns服务被调度到内存压力高的节点,导致kube dns被逐出并重新启动。在此期间,一些请求将无法解决。为了解决这个问题,我创建了一个kube系统服务专用的nodepool,然后编辑了kube系统部署,并设置了一个nodeSelector,以便始终将它们调度到安全节点。此后,该问题已停止